Cole Court is in Didcot and in South Oxfordshire district. OX11 7XL is located in the Didcot North East elect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Wantage. This postcode has been in use since 1996-12-01.

Safety

Is Cole Court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Cole Court was 5.9 per 1,000 residents, which is 87.6% lower than the Didcot North East average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.

Cole Court has the lowest crime rate of 24 local areas in Didcot North East and the 12th lowest crime rate of 456 local areas in South Oxfordshire .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 3.0 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 192.3%.

Employment

OX11 7XL area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 3%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.
